Transaction e62752354236de30dff6fc9c85a3f442375352925ea8f636ee754d7943b35ad2
1 Input
1 Output
-
e62752354236de30dff6fc9c85a3f442375352925ea8f636ee754d7943b35ad2:0
- value
- 6483138
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4663f2039819cff520f9489bf91c1d9c8333e219 OP_EQUAL
- address
- 387CxJDsvwuqgjqmKrf59irFedo4WkPPFb